The name Gordon Mote is well known in Southern Gospel Music.  Gordon spent many years as the piano player for the Gaither Vocal Band and the Gaither Homecoming Videos.  He is also an accomplished studio musician and producer and a proficient singer.  Gordon recently set out on a solo ministry and his latest solo project, on New Haven Records, is an outstanding effort that is likely to please all of his current fans and get him many new ones as well!

The project starts out with an upbeat song titled “All Things New.”  I love the message of this song as it reminds us that God can make all things new if we believe in Him.  It is also the title song from the recording.  The tempo slows down on the next song with “Faith Like That.”  The song tells a story of a father who lost a son and the tremendous faith in God that he had.  It is very touching and an excellent message.  “Ain’t It Just Like The Lord” picks up the pace once again and wow is this a good song!  It reminds us that God can do the impossible and He is still performing miracles today!  The next song on the project is a beautiful ballad titled “Meanwhile Back At The Cross.”  What a wonderful message of how God’s Blood still bring forgiveness and mercy.

This is our second project to review from Zandra Brown! I said in the first review that her music is not Southern Gospel but that her talent was too great to ignore and this project is much the same way.  Zandra’s new project has thirteen songs on it that are all written or co-written by Zandra and each one tells a personal story from her life.  Like all of us, Zandra has experienced ups and down in life and you can feel and hear the emotion in each of these songs.

The project gets off to a kickin’ start with the title song “It’s Your Life.”  This song is sure to become a quick favorite as it encourages to live life in spite of the circumstances of our life.  “Your Love Is Good” is the next song on the project and it an awesome song about the day that Zandra gave her life to Christ.  I think it conveys the message of what most of feel about that day in our life.  “Lies” picks up the pace once again and this fast song leads right into the slow tempo “I Refuse To Break.”  That song reminds us of the crazy pace that our life can have sometimes and how we need to refuse to break under that pressure!

“Only You Alone” is an awesome song that I really enjoyed.  It is written about God and only Him alone is our strength and peace forever.  “Missing You” is a personal song that Zandra wrote to her husband and it is an awesome song for anyone who is missing that special someone in their life.  The next song on the project is “If I Had One Wish” and it is a song that will be enjoyed by the listener.  “I’ll Pray For You” is the next song on the project and this song offers a unique perspective of praying for someone who has hurt you.  I love the song and we should all strive to do that!  Next on the project we find the song “Heaven Knows” and it is another great song.
